| Psalms | 73 | (13) Verily I have cleansed my heart in vain, and washed my hands in innocency. | |
| Psalms | 73 | (14) For all the day long have I been plagued, and chastened every morning. | |
| Psalms | 73 | (15) If I say, I will speak thus; behold, I should offend against the generation of thy children. | |
| Psalms | 73 | (16) When I thought to know this, it was too painful for me; | |
| Psalms | 73 | (17) Until I went into the sanctuary of God; then understood I their end. | |
| Psalms | 73 | (18) Surely thou didst set them in slippery places: thou castedst them down into destruction. | |
| Psalms | 73 | (19) How are they brought into desolation, as in a moment! they are utterly consumed with terrors. | |
| Psalms | 73 | (20) As a dream when one awaketh; so, O Lord, when thou awakest, thou shalt despise their image. | |
| Psalms | 73 | (21) Thus my heart was grieved, and I was pricked in my reins. | |
| Psalms | 73 | (22) So foolish was I, and ignorant: I was as a beast before thee. | |
| Psalms | 73 | (23) Nevertheless I am continually with thee: thou hast holden me by my right hand. | |
| Psalms | 73 | (24) Thou shalt guide me with thy counsel, and afterward receive me to glory. | |
| Psalms | 73 | (25) Whom have I in heaven but thee? and there is none upon earth that I desire beside thee. | |
| Psalms | 73 | (26) My flesh and my heart faileth: but God is the strength of my heart, and my portion for ever. | |
| Psalms | 73 | (27) For, lo, they that are far from thee shall perish: thou hast destroyed all them that go awhoring from thee. | |
| Psalms | 73 | (28) But it is good for me to draw near to God: I have put my trust in the Lord GOD, that I may declare all thy works. | |
| Psalms | 74 | (0) Title: Maschil of Asaph | |
| Psalms | 74 | (1) O GOD, why hast thou cast us off for ever? why doth thine anger smoke against the sheep of thy pasture? | |
| Psalms | 74 | (2) Remember thy congregation, which thou hast purchased of old; the rod of thine inheritance, which thou hast redeemed; this mount Zion, wherein thou hast dwelt. | |
| Psalms | 74 | (3) Lift up thy feet unto the perpetual desolations; even all that the enemy hath done wickedly in the sanctuary. | |
